 
                Alicia Cook MA, LCMHC
With over a decade of experience in the mental health field, Alicia specializes in helping individuals and families cultivate healthier, more intentional relationships—with themselves, others, and the world around them. Her approach is rooted in curiosity, compassion, and a deep understanding that meaningful change begins with connection.
Alicia’s journey into psychotherapy and mindset coaching began through her own exploration of healing—from navigating early family dynamics and self-esteem challenges to managing a Crohn’s diagnosis during high school. These personal experiences fuel her passion for guiding clients toward emotional resilience, self-awareness, and balance in all areas of life—including relationships, exercise, and food.
Certified in somatic embodiment and regulation strategies, Alicia integrates body-based awareness with relational and mindset work to help clients build confidence, presence, and inner strength. She is especially passionate about parent coaching, supporting caregivers in fostering deeper, more conscious connections with their children.
Known for her non-judgmental and warm presence, Alicia creates a safe space for growth and reflection. Outside of her work, she enjoys time with her husband and children and is committed to her own ongoing journey of learning, self-discovery, and wellness.
Education: Bachelor's in Psychology (2011) Master's in Clinical Mental Health Counseling (2015)
